Jaguar Type 01 EV Interior Revealed: A Leap Towards Modern Minimalism






Jaguar's highly anticipated Type 01 EV is rapidly approaching its production debut, and the automaker has now offered a first look at its interior. This new electric vehicle marks a significant departure from Jaguar's classic design philosophy, embracing a modern, minimalist aesthetic that redefines the brand's luxury appeal. The cabin, designed for four occupants, foregoes traditional elements in favor of sleek lines and advanced technology, aligning with contemporary EV trends.
The interior design of the Jaguar Type 01 EV emphasizes a minimalist approach, characterized by clean, straight lines and a noticeable reduction in conventional switchgear. This design philosophy is increasingly common in modern electric vehicles, evident in models from various manufacturers. However, Jaguar distinguishes the Type 01 by integrating unique design cues that set it apart within this evolving aesthetic. The focus on horizontal elements, particularly a prominent central console that extends the full length of the cabin, creates a sense of spaciousness and sophisticated linearity. Door armrests and panel trim echo this horizontal motif, while distinctive straked elements on the dashboard connect with exterior design details near the windshield. Even the two-spoke steering wheel incorporates horizontal lines, reinforcing the overarching design theme.
Functionality meets futuristic design in the Type 01's cockpit. A camera-based digital rearview mirror projects its display at the base of the windshield, enhancing visibility and reducing clutter. A substantial digital screen is positioned directly in front of the driver, providing essential information, while a smaller central touchscreen integrates climate controls and other functions. The steering wheel features haptic-touch buttons for intuitive control, complemented by two traditional column stalks. Above, a single-pane glass roof, though somewhat narrow, extends significantly towards the rear, bathing the cabin in natural light. The four seats are meticulously sculpted, prioritizing comfort and support, offering what Jaguar describes as a 'GT driving position.' Instead of conventional wood and chrome, the interior boasts a metallic brass finish on the doors and console, adding a touch of contemporary elegance.
The interior reveal of the Type 01 EV is taking place during Monterey Car Week, with the vehicle's exterior still under camouflage. Enthusiasts and industry observers alike are eagerly awaiting the full unveiling of the production model, scheduled for October 6. This event is expected to provide comprehensive details about the Type 01's exterior design, performance specifications, and other innovative features, marking a pivotal moment in Jaguar's electrification journey.
